diff options
author | José Valim <jose.valim@gmail.com> | 2012-01-03 23:43:26 -0800 |
---|---|---|
committer | José Valim <jose.valim@gmail.com> | 2012-01-03 23:43:26 -0800 |
commit | a10f30963d9dfb8b470e2ec5e293b20be8fcbe3d (patch) | |
tree | 9a47272576e438d68c50901f090bb8379fa6ed11 /activerecord/test | |
parent | 63f7a61246aa570ed6891cdd225df8d67e4ecc13 (diff) | |
parent | 6012970fea9d3385cd0a515aa353b47d0837d55a (diff) | |
download | rails-a10f30963d9dfb8b470e2ec5e293b20be8fcbe3d.tar.gz rails-a10f30963d9dfb8b470e2ec5e293b20be8fcbe3d.tar.bz2 rails-a10f30963d9dfb8b470e2ec5e293b20be8fcbe3d.zip |
Merge pull request #4288 from kennyj/fix_4285-2
(3-2-stable) Fix GH #4285. Remove options when we record calling create_table
Diffstat (limited to 'activerecord/test')
-rw-r--r-- | activerecord/test/cases/migration/command_recorder_test.rb | 6 |
1 files changed, 6 insertions, 0 deletions
diff --git a/activerecord/test/cases/migration/command_recorder_test.rb b/activerecord/test/cases/migration/command_recorder_test.rb index d108b456f0..8f136bce2b 100644 --- a/activerecord/test/cases/migration/command_recorder_test.rb +++ b/activerecord/test/cases/migration/command_recorder_test.rb @@ -67,6 +67,12 @@ module ActiveRecord assert_equal [:drop_table, [:system_settings]], drop_table end + def test_invert_create_table_with_options + @recorder.record :create_table, [:people_reminders, {:id => false}] + drop_table = @recorder.inverse.first + assert_equal [:drop_table, [:people_reminders]], drop_table + end + def test_invert_rename_table @recorder.record :rename_table, [:old, :new] rename = @recorder.inverse.first |